SYNAGOGUE

Constructed in 1568, this is the oldest synagogue in the Commonwealth. Destroyed
in a shelling during the Portuguese raid in 1662, it was rebuilt two years later
by the Dutch.
Known for mid 18
th century hand painted, willow patterned floor tiles
from Canton in China, a clock tower, Hebrew inscriptions on stone slabs, great
scrolls of the Old Testament, ancient scripts on copper plates etc.
